From 9dcd46efea53f53577246237a94a9b5980d6c568 Mon Sep 17 00:00:00 2001 From: mark burdett Date: Mon, 11 Mar 2019 15:04:23 -0700 Subject: [PATCH] Non-multipart body is now an ezcMailFile object stored in tmp directory. --- CRM/Utils/Mail/EmailProcessor.php | 3 +++ 1 file changed, 3 insertions(+) diff --git a/CRM/Utils/Mail/EmailProcessor.php b/CRM/Utils/Mail/EmailProcessor.php index 5f609153b4..3c9842d9e2 100644 --- a/CRM/Utils/Mail/EmailProcessor.php +++ b/CRM/Utils/Mail/EmailProcessor.php @@ -290,6 +290,9 @@ class CRM_Utils_Mail_EmailProcessor { elseif ($mail->body instanceof ezcMailMultipart) { $text = self::getTextFromMultipart($mail->body); } + elseif ($mail->body instanceof ezcMailFile) { + $text = file_get_contents($mail->body->__get('fileName')); + } if ( empty($text) && -- 2.25.1